Eternity of Life

I will live on forever… Until the searing sun burst, When only ashes can become memories Until the moon shines the day, With darkening fading shadows Until every bright star would fall, Making wishes every second Until the mountains would crumble, As its top would even my feet Until the wind stops its journey, No longer dancing to the music of life Until nature would grow intensely, Covering every space and sound Until the rains would fall, Not in the shapes of solemn tears Until all these has been revealed, And proven by my naked eyes I will live on forever…
